BNESIM does not provide a true unlimited high‑speed data eSIM for Mexico. The plan labeled “Mexico Unlimited 10 days” only allows 3GB of high‑speed data per day; after that limit the speed is throttled to 1000kbps. All other BNESIM plans for Mexican coverage have explicit data caps, such as 100GB for 30 days or 50GB for 30 days.
Travelers who need large data allowances can choose from BNESIM’s fixed‑data options, for example the 100GB plan for 30 days priced at $147.86 USD or the 50GB plan for 30 days priced at $101.41 USD. These fixed plans can be more cost‑effective for users whose data usage is substantial but who do not require truly unlimited data.
BNESIM does not provide eSIM plans that include a phone number or SMS capability for Mexico. Travelers can only purchase data‑only eSIMs with this provider and must rely on internet‑based messaging and calling services such as WhatsApp, Telegram, or iMessage to communicate.
BNESIM offers fifteen single‑country data plans that cover Mexico and an additional twenty multi‑country plans that include Mexico among their destinations. The majority of these plans use fixed data caps, while a single option provides a daily data cap instead. The price of Mexico‑specific plans ranges from about $3.28 to $276.83, and the data allowances go from 1 GB up to 100 GB. Most plans allow tethering, and a few apply a reduced speed limit of 1000 kbit/s.
